You can use RDWORKS software to enter the manufacturer's parameter settings, check the maximum speed setting of the X/Y axis, and check the processing speed of the layer parameters after importing the file, and make the processing speed normal by modifying the speed values of these two positions.

Hello, please check whether the laser attenuation is set to 100% in the manufacturer's parameters, if it is set, it will cause your feedback to this situation, and you can set the value to zero again.
